Hach® TNTplus™ Vial Test System for Photometric Water Analysis …
Reduced errors – Automatic method detection with bar-coded vials. Scratched, flawed, or dirty glassware becomes non-issue as instrument averages 10 readings and rejects outliers. Safe handling – Innovative vial and reagent delivery significantly reduces spillage or contamination risk.

The TNTplus system gives you maximum accuracy, precision and repeatability, while minimizing the opportunity for errors. Vials feature freeze-dried reagent integrated into a sealed cap. A unique barcode on each vial is automatically read by Hach spectrophotometers to identify the appropriate method and take the measurement.
